Squad imposes fine Rs 13150 on erring traders
12/9/2016 9:59:04 PM

Early Times Report
RAMBAN, Dec 9: Special market checking squad conducted market checking in Ramban and Chanderkote town to ensure that people get quality edibles and essential commodities with reasonable rates and imposed Rs 13150 from erring traders.
A joint team comprising Tehsildar Ramban Gurpreet Singh, Naib Tehsildar GH Sehmat and TSO Ramban Nazir Ahmed besides officers of different departments carried out a surprise checking. During the inspection, Rs. 13150 was realised as fine from defaulters by checking squads. All the shopkeepers, dabawales and vendors were directed to maintain hygiene and quality of eatables and also ensure display of price list.
The team checked the rates of fruits, vegetables, milk, chicken, mutton and other eatables besides inspecting the quality of these commodities.
